OK,  here are my first results :

First boot of 'BOOTX.poll' kernel, delivers 

 - on boot sequence the same behavior on my ZIP, this is
   wainting about 20 seconds then showing the error-messages
sd1 at scsibus0 targ 6 lun 0: <IOMEGA, ZIP 100, R.41> SCSI2 0/direct removable
sd1: sd1(ncrscsi0:6:0): illegal request, 
	data = ff fe 01 05 c9 00 00 00 00 00 00 00 00 00 00 00 00
sd1: could not mode sense (4); using fictitious geometry
This messages were also shown when I 'disklabel' or 'newfs' the ZIP

 - fsck /home (= /dev/sd0f on SCSI disk) brought many 'st_pool_size' mesages
   on screen takes a long time and then kernel crashed with 'MMU fault'.
But I think the reason could be an incorrect /home-filesystem.

This crash was reproductable with the other kernel BOOTX.intr

But then reboot with both kernel works ok, also fsck in boot phase of all
partitions ( / /usr and also /home) works fine.

After this, reading a tar-file from a ZIP-disk in MSDOS format brought ONE
kernel hung, but after the next reboot I got NO hung or crash either :)

With kernel BOOTX.poll I then did :
	- binpatch'ing _st_pool_size with several values (see my mail before)
	- making a new filesystem on ZIP
	- writing tar-files of / and /usr on this new ZIP partition 
	  and reading that files.
NO ONE error message appeared and no more kernel crash or hung - up to now
